For over fifty years now, folks have been calling Loch Raven Village “home”.   Maybe it’s the low-maintenance all-brick exteriors and beautifully detailed interiors that feature plaster walls and hardwood floors.  Maybe it’s the location: convenient to major highways yet comfortably suburban and very affordable.  Or maybe it’s just the friendly Village atmosphere that makes it an outstanding neighborhood in which to live and raise a family.  If you’re looking for a home but want more than just four walls and a roof, come on over and see us...you’ll feel like a neighbor already!   

image (16K)The Village is ideally located in Baltimore County, just east of Towson.  It is within walking distance of many public, private, and parochial schools covering preschool through high school.  Towson University and Goucher College are about 5 minutes from the Village.

The brick Georgian colonial townhomes are spacious -- inside groups 20 ft. x 30 ft., and end homes 24 ft. x 30 ft., many with one or two wood burning fireplaces. Foundations are concrete block, and the interior walls are made of plaster. The square footage is greater than many individual homes of comparable price.  Property values have remained high due in part to restrictive covenants imposed on the Village by the developer to insure a uniformly attractive appearance and to control professional activity.
